flydubai offers increased flexibility to passengers

flydubai, Dubai's first low cost airline, has changed to provide passengers with more options and flexibility to suit their requirements and budget.
The changes include more types of fare, and alterations to both the checked baggage allowance and hand baggage rules.

The previous rules still apply to all bookings made before December 6. However, if passengers with existing bookings change their flights or wish to add pre-purchased baggage, the new rules will come in to effect.
flydubai's changes:
The changes to hand luggage rules now enable passengers to bring a small carry on bag, plus a small laptop bag or a handbag.
Hand baggage must not weigh more than 7 kg or be larger than 56 cm x 45 cm x 25 cm. The weight and size of the hand baggage will be checked to ensure it can be placed in the overhead locker or safely under the seat directly in front.
The changes to fares include three distinct categories, providing flydubai customers greater flexibility in tailoring their travel to their budget and needs. The "No Change" fare means once it is paid for, the booking cannot be changed or cancelled. It includes one piece of hand luggage weighing no more than 7kg and not larger than 56cm x 45cm x 25cm in addition to a small laptop bag or handbag.
The "Pay to Change" fare allows passengers to change or cancel their flight up to 24 hours before departure at a cost of AED 100 per person, per flight, plus the difference in fare. If the new fare is lower, a flydubai voucher will be issued. The cost of cancelled flights will also be refunded via a voucher less the AED 150 cancellation fee, per person, per flight. Flights cannot be cancelled less than 24 hours before departure, and no name changes are permitted. The fare includes one piece of hand luggage weighing up to 7kg and not larger than 56cm x 45cm x 25cm plus a small laptop bag or handbag.
The "Free to Change" fare, meanwhile, includes a 20kg checked baggage allowance, in addition to one piece of hand luggage weighing no more than 7kg and no larger than 56cm x 45cm x 25cm and a small laptop bag or handbag. The flight can be changed up to 24 hours before departure, with only the difference in price to pay. If the fare is lower, a flydubai voucher will be issued for the difference. If the booking is changed less than 24 hours before departure, a charge of AED 365 will be imposed per flight, plus the difference in price.
Cancellations to Free to Change fares can be made up to 24 hours before departure. Passengers will receive a voucher for the full amount less the AED 150 cancellation fee. Cancellations made less than 24 hours before departure will be subject to an AED 365 fee. Passengers who do not make their flight will also receive a voucher for the total amount less the AED 365 fee. No name changes can be made under this fare.
All fares are per person, one way and inclusive of all taxes.
Passengers can also pre-purchase a checked baggage weight allowance of 20kg, 30kg or 40kg. Each weight allows people to bring up to three pieces but no bag should exceed 75cm x 55cm x 35cm, nor weigh more than 32kg. Pre-checked baggage allowances can be pre-purchased at a discount up to four hours before the flight via www.flydubai.com or through the call centre on +9714 301 0800.
Subject to availability, checked baggage can be purchased at the airport at the applicable per kilo rate.
Airport baggage rates will also apply if a passenger exceeds their pre-purchased allowance, if they have not pre-purchased baggage, or if they exceed three pieces of luggage (even if the total weight is less than the pre-purchased weight allowance).
Background Information
flydubai
flydubai began operations in 2009 with the aim of taking more people to more places, more often. In just a few years, flydubai has firmly established its place in the region. Today, we fly to more than 90 destinations operating out of Dubai International (DXB) and Al Maktoum International (DWC). We’re creating opportunities for travel, tourism and trade across the region. By opening up new markets, we’re changing the way people look at travel while contributing to the growth of Dubai as an aviation hub.
